亚星管理平台

yax 2026-02-27 293
亚星管理平台摘要: 随着数字化时代的飞速发展,API已经成为连接不同软件系统的核心桥梁,在这个背景下,API文档的管理和自动化生成显得尤为重要,Swagger作为一种流行的API文档自动化工具,正引领着API文档的新时代,本文将详细介绍Swagger的概念、特...

随着数字化时代的飞速发展,API已经成为连接不同软件系统的核心桥梁,在这个背景下,API文档的管理和自动化生成显得尤为重要,Swagger作为一种流行的API文档自动化工具,正引领着API文档的新时代,本文将详细介绍Swagger的概念、特点,以及如何利用它来提高工作效率。

Swagger发文,探索API文档自动化的新时代

Swagger是一种强大的API文档工具,它能够帮助开发人员快速生成清晰、易于理解的API文档,通过Swagger,开发人员可以轻松地自动创建、管理和测试API文档,Swagger还支持多种语言和框架,使得跨平台开发更加便捷。

Swagger的特点

  1. 自动化生成:Swagger能够根据代码自动生成API文档,大幅度减少手动编写文档的工作量。
  2. 易于理解:Swagger生成的API文档格式规范,易于阅读和理解,有效降低开发人员的沟通成本。
  3. 交互性强:Swagger支持在线模拟API请求和响应,让开发人员能够方便地测试API。
  4. 跨平台支持:Swagger对多种编程语言和框架都提供了良好的支持,具备出色的兼容性。
  5. 强大的文档管理功能:Swagger提供了完善的文档管理功能,方便开发人员对API文档进行版本控制、协作和分享。

如何运用Swagger提高工作效率

  1. 集成Swagger到开发流程:将Swagger集成到开发环境中,使开发人员能够更轻松地生成和管理API文档。
  2. 利用Swagger UI:通过Swagger UI,在线浏览API文档,并模拟API请求,从而提高测试效率。
  3. 使用Swagger Codegen:根据Swagger API定义自动生成客户端和服务器端的代码,加快开发进度。
  4. 实施版本控制:利用Swagger进行版本控制,确保API文档的更新和变更能够被有效追踪和管理。
  5. 加强团队协作:通过Swagger的分享和协作功能,促进团队成员间的沟通和合作,从而提高整体的工作效率。

Swagger作为一种API文档自动化工具,为开发人员带来了极大的便利,通过其自动化生成、易于理解、交互性强、跨平台支持和文档管理等特点,Swagger有助于提高开发效率,降低沟通成本,为了最大化地发挥Swagger的优势,开发人员应该将其深度集成到开发流程中,并充分利用Swagger UI、Codegen、版本控制和团队协作等功能,随着Swagger的不断发展与完善,我们期待它在API文档管理领域创造更多的价值,为开发人员带来更加便捷的工作体验。